Your Apple Watch can now open your hotel room door at over 100 Starwood Hotels

starwoodpartnership

Starwood Hotels has allowed guests to use their iPhone as their room key since last November, and today announced that guests can now use the group’s Apple Watch app to unlock room doors at more than 100 properties. You can also use the app to get directions to the hotel and to check-in.

“We’re committed to mobile and digital innovation and are excited to be the first hotel company to let guests check in and open their hotel room door with their Apple Watch,” said Mark Vondrasek, Senior Vice President, Distribution, Loyalty and Partnership Marketing for Starwood Hotels & Resorts. “Apple Watch allows us to engage with our guests and give them the information they need instantaneously in a simple yet extremely stylish way. ”

For regular guests, the app offers two additional functions … 

It can display details for up to four further bookings – displaying the hotel name, booked dates and photo – and receive alerts when new points are added to their Starwood Preferred Guest account.

Tim Cook said back in March that the Apple Watch would soon unlock doors at “some of the best hotels in the world.”

The Starwood Preferred Guest app is available today in English, with Spanish, Chinese and Japanese localizations coming soon. The app is a free download via the iPhone app on the App Store.
